Sanford D. Bringle was inducted into the U.S Army Air Corps at Fort Oglethorpe, Georgia on  January 8, 1943. He went to chemical warfare  training  in Siberia, Alabama. He served with the 894th Chemical Company, 3rd Attack Group of the 5th Air Force. His campaigns were new guinea, the western pacific, Bismarck archipelago, the Southern Philippines including Leyte, Mindora and Luzon. He was on Okinawa when peace was declared, then he moved to Japan with the occupation force. Sanford was discharged at Fort McPherson, Georgia on November 20, 1945. His awards included the good conduct medal, ww ii victory medal, philippine liberation medal with one bronze star and the asiatic- pacific service medal with one silver star. His highest rank held was corporal. Sanford married Jane Alexander Bringle; his children were Patsy Bringle Pennington, Sandy Bringle Swanson, and Mike Bringle.
